- LT5575 800MHz to 2.7GHz High Linearity Direct Conversion Quadrature Demodulator DESCRIPTION
The LT®5575 is an 800MHz to 2.7GHz direct conversion quadrature demodulator optimized for high linearity receiver applications. It is suitable for munications receivers where an RF signal is directly converted into I and Q baseband signals with bandwidth up to 490MHz. The LT5575 incorporates balanced I and Q mixers, LO buffer amplifiers and a precision, high frequency quadrature phase shifter. The integrated on-chip broadband transformers provide 50Ω single-ended interfaces at the RF and LO inputs. Only a few external capacitors are needed for its application in an RF receiver system. The high linearity of the LT5575 provides excellent spurfree dynamic range for the receiver. This direct conversion demodulator can eliminate the need for intermediate frequency (IF) signal processing, as well as the corresponding requirements for image filtering and IF filtering. Channel filtering can be performed directly at the outputs of the I and Q channels. These outputs can interface directly to channel-select filters (LPFs) or to baseband amplifiers.

- Operation over a wider frequency range is possible with reduced performance. Consult the factory.
Input Frequency Range: 0.8GHz to 2.7GHz- 50Ω Single-Ended RF and LO Ports High IIP3: 28d Bm at 900MHz, 22.6d Bm at 1.9GHz High IIP2: 54.1d Bm at 900MHz, 60d Bm at 1.9GHz Input P1d B: 13.2d Bm at 900MHz I/Q Gain Mismatch: 0.04d B Typical I/Q Phase Mismatch: 0.4° Typical Low Output DC Offsets Noise Figure: 12.8d B at 900MHz, 12.7d B at 1.9GHz Conversion Gain: 3d B at 900MHz, 4.2d B at 1.9GHz Very Few External ponents Shutdown Mode 16-Lead QFN 4mm × 4mm Package with Exposed Pad
